TOOLS FOR TITRATING NEWĀ IDEAS AND PRACTICES FOR COREGULATIONĀ
As dependent children, misattunement, neglect, or abuse can overwhelm our nervous systems, leading to dysregulation and shutdown. This childhood stress creates developmental gaps, shaping lasting patterns. To survive unsafe caregiving, we adapt through neuroplasticity, developing strategies like blocking sensations, seeking attention, fawning, or dissociating. These patterns, starting to be formed in infancy and continuing through stages of development, were essential for safety.
WhenĀ We Have Not Felt Safe, Safety Does NOT Feel SAFE!
